What is Amazon’s Prime Early Access Sale (‘October Prime Day’)?
While the actual October Prime Day runs on Oct. 11 and 12, Prime Members also got access to thousands of early deals on everything from home goods to TVs in the days leading up to it. The Prime Early Access Sale follows the same formula as the July Prime Day event, except that it’s geared toward holiday gift shopping, so you can get a jump on shopping for everyone on your list.
When is Amazon Prime Early Access Sale (‘October Prime Day’)?
Amazon’s October Prime Day will run on Oct. 11 and 12. But Prime Members can take advantage of early deals and sales in the days leading up to the actual event.
